Firm Profile

Rockpoint is a real estate private equity firm that employs a fundamental value approach to investing, targeting select product types and markets throughout the United States. The firm applies a consistent and disciplined investment approach across its investment programs, which span distinct return profiles. Since 1994, the firm’s co-founders with others have sponsored 19 investment vehicles and related co-investment vehicles through Rockpoint and a predecessor firm and have invested or committed to invest in 512 transactions with a total peak capitalization of approximately $82 billion. Position Overview

As an integral member of Rockpoint’s Technology Team, this role will be focused on supporting our IT infrastructure in a hybrid environment residing in VMware on-premises and Azure or AWS in the cloud. This role is for an IT professional with proven experience in an enterprise environment who thrive on maintaining operations at a dynamic company, driving enhancements to our end-users, and collaborating across functions. This role will take ownership of Rockpoint’s server and application infrastructure, identifying and implementing measures to improve reliability, resiliency, efficiency, and performance in accordance with cybersecurity and compliance requirements. Additional responsibilities include being an escalation point and mentor to team members as required for employee technical support.  This position reports directly to the Head of Technology.


Responsibilities

  • Own and maintain the Microsoft 365 infrastructure application stack including Teams (Teams Telephony), Exchange Online, InTune, SharePoint, and OneDrive
  • Implement and manage infrastructure systems running in Microsoft Azure and AWS environments
  • Deploy knowledge and skills to support the planning, installation, integration, and configuration of infrastructure systems and networks in a multi-office, geographically dispersed enterprise
  • Conduct data backup and restoration procedures for servers and user data, maintaining and testing long term archives in a regulated environment
  • Perform advanced troubleshooting and problem resolution for infrastructure components including servers, network switches, and firewalls and serve as a point of escalation for advanced endpoint and infrastructure issues
  • Assist with regular planning and testing of business continuity, compliance programs, and related policies
  • Administer and respond to support requests as an escalation point for the technology support team
  • Provide mentorship and training to technologists to improve organization support
  • Participate in after-hours support on a rotational basis
  • May be required to lift 50lbs infrequently

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in technology or related area with proven academic performance
  • 3+ years of experience in a junior administrator or equivalent role highly preferred
  • Demonstrates strong interpersonal skills with the ability to clearly and concisely communicate complex technical concepts to a variety of end users
  • Experience managing multi-office infrastructure systems, including monitoring, real-time replication, backup systems, high-availability services, and on-premise to cloud migrations of VMs and services; efficiently leverages cloud resources across AWS and Azure
  • Ability to troubleshoot and resolve advanced endpoint, infrastructure, connectivity, and network issues in complex multi-platform environments
  • Plans and executes cybersecurity and compliance initiatives while implementing and maintaining modern authentication practices such as SSO and MFA
  • Able to demonstrate expertise administering all aspects of Microsoft 365, Azure, and AWS environments in a fast-paced and regulated environment
  • Demonstrated experience with Microsoft PowerShell automation or similar automation language preferred
  • Strong documentation, project management, organizational, time management, and prioritization skills
  • Demonstrated capacity to take ownership, be accountable, and learn quickly
  • Team-player, with an ability to solve problems while collaborating with various interdepartmental personnel
  • Intelligence, integrity, drive, and flexibility

What We Do

Rockhill Management, L.L.C. (“Rockhill”), an affiliate of Rockpoint, is a dedicated property services management company that serves commercial and residential properties in select markets throughout the United States. Rockhill employs a responsive, tailored approach and the most current technologies to property and relationship management in order to deliver customized service, premium amenities, and intentional communities across Rockpoint’s portfolio. Since inception, Rockhill has provided property management, project management, and other services to properties representing approximately 49.1 million square feet.
